Day: May 5, 2024


Game On with Makalza: A Look at the Browser Games Revolutionizing Streaming

In recent years, the world of online gaming has undergone a significant transformation. From high-end console titles to mobile apps, gamers now have more options than ever when it comes to finding their next gaming fix. One platform that’s been making waves in the gaming community is Makalza, a streaming service that offers a unique […]

Read More